Management Commentary

During the Q1 2026 earnings call, Seagate’s management highlighted the company’s ability to deliver solid earnings per share of $4.1 amid a measured recovery in the storage market. Executives noted that demand from cloud and enterprise customers continues to provide a foundation for the nearline hard disk drive segment, while ongoing cost discipline helped support margins. Operational improvements in manufacturing efficiency and supply chain management were cited as key levers that contributed to the quarter’s results. Management also touched on the increasing importance of mass-capacity storage driven by AI training workloads and data archiving, though they acknowledged that near-term demand signals remain mixed across certain end markets. The team emphasized their focus on capital allocation, including debt reduction and returning value to shareholders through dividends, while investing selectively in next-generation HAMR technology. No specific revenue figure was disclosed in this release. Overall, the commentary suggested cautious optimism, with management noting that macroeconomic uncertainties persist but that Seagate’s product portfolio is well-positioned to capture long-term secular trends in data growth. Forward Guidance

Seagate’s management, following its recently released Q1 2026 results featuring EPS of $4.10, provided a cautiously optimistic forward outlook. The company anticipates that the ongoing recovery in cloud and enterprise storage demand may continue to support revenue momentum in the coming quarters. While macroeconomic uncertainties persist, Seagate expects its nearline HDD product line to benefit from the increasing need for cost-effective mass data storage, particularly as AI and machine learning applications drive data center expansion. In its guidance, the company indicated that gross margins could experience some sequential variability due to product mix shifts and the timing of higher-cost inputs, but it sees potential for improvement as volume scales. Seagate is also focusing on operational discipline and cost efficiencies, which management believes may contribute to margin stability. The firm did not provide a specific numeric forecast for the next quarter beyond its usual commentary, but it highlighted that demand trends in the hyperscale segment appear constructive. Additionally, Seagate’s ongoing investments in heat-assisted magnetic recording (HAMR) technology could position it well to address long-term capacity needs, though the revenue contribution from that platform may remain modest in the near term. Overall, Seagate’s outlook reflects cautious confidence in gradual demand recovery, tempered by broader economic headwinds.
